AS A SENIOR (2010-2011): (XC) Redshirted...Ran 24:27 in the SCU Bronco Invitational...Earned 1st and a PR in the 8k at the Doc Adams Invite in 24:10. (TRACK) Place 3rd in the 800m with 1:54:09 @ Cal State Stanislaus 3/5/11…Ran 1:54:02 for 5th overall in the 800m @UC Davis Aggie Open 3/12/11…Competed in his first 1500m of the season in 3:55:01, his best-ever seasonal debut @ Stanford 3/25/11…Finished 11th in the 5000m for a life-time best time of 14:56:71 @ Chico State 4/8-9/11…Won the 1500 in 3:53:53 for his best time of the season @ Woody Wilson Invitational, UC Davis 4/16/11…Placed 4th overall in the 1500m with a time of 3:53:15 for a season best finish @ Brutus Hamilton Invitational, CAL 4/22/11...Ran a season best time in the 1500m @ the WCC Championships on 5/14/11 in 3:51:73.

AS A JUNIOR (2009-2010): (XC) The top runner for the Santa Clara men’s cross country team in 2009, placed 11th at the Stanford Invite with a time of 24:30… won the Bronco Invite with a time of 24:32… came in 2nd at the West Coast Conference Championships with a time of 24:56… placed 52nd at the NCAA West Regional’s with a time of 32:01. (TRACK) Competed in the 5000m in 14:59:27 and ran a sub-15 minute 5000m despite the driving rain and heavy winds @ the Benny Brown Invitational, Cal State Fullerton 3/6/10…Ran a season best in the 1500m in 3:56:73 and ran a personal best and school record of 1:53:40 in the 800m @ Stanford Invitational 3/26/10…Finished the 800m in 1:54:93 @ Johnny Mathis Invitational 4/3/10…Raced 1:53:77 in the 800m and 3:59:67 in the 1500m @ Chico Twilight Invitational 4/10/10…Placed 4th in the fastest heat of the 1500m in 3:57:03 @ Woody Wilson, UC Davis 4/17/10…Re-set his school record in the 800m by one-hundredth second faster in 1:53:39 and finished the 1500m in 3:50:92, also besting his previous school record @ Brutus Hamilton Invitational, Cal 4/23/10…Ran his best time ever in the 1500m, at 3:51:96 @ Sac State, 5/8/10.

AS A SOPHOMORE (2008-2009): (XC) WCC 1st Team All-Conference 2008 when he finished ninth. Earned a PR in the 10k at the NCAA West Regional Championships with a time of 31:14:35. (TRACK) Finished the 5000m in 14:57:60, 4th on the SCU all-time top times list @ Gator Preview SF State 3/7/09… Earned a PR in the 1500m in 3:54:16@ UC Davis Aggie Open 3/14/09…Finished in the top 10 of the 1500m in 4:01:66 @ Hornet Invitational, 3/21/09… Ran a lifetime best in the 800m in 1:54:41 @ Johnny Mathis Invitational, 4/5/09… Raced a PR in the 1500m in 3:54:16 for 4th place @ Woody Wilson Invitational, 4/10/09…Finished the 1500m in 3:57:45 @ Bryan Clay Invitational, 4/17/09… Earned a PR of 1:54:29 in the 800m and ran the 1500m in 3:56:89 @ Brutus Hamilton Invitational 4/24/09.

AS A FRESHMAN (2007-2008): (XC) Ran 26:31 in the USF Invitational...Finished the Stanford Invite in 26:10...Raced 25:59 in the SCU Bronco Invite 10/13/07...Ran 26:15 at the WCC Championship...Finished the NCAA West Regionals Championship, a 10k race in 33:25:75 on 11/10/07. (TRACK) Earned a seasonal PR in the 800m in 1:55:89 against USF and in the 1500m in 3:59:13 at the Brutus Hamilton Invite.

COLLEGE PERSONAL BESTS

Cross Country: 24:10 in the 8k for 1st place (2010 - Doc Adams); 31:14 in the 10k for 70th place (2008 - Regionals); 32:01 52nd place @ Regionals (Springfield, OR) 11/14/09
Track:
1:53.39 in the 800m (2010 - Brutus Hamilton); 1500m 3:50.92 (2010 - Brutus Hamilton); 5k 14:56:71 (2011 - Chico State)

HIGH SCHOOL: A 2007 graduate of Mountain View High School in Mountain View, Calif. ... Coached by Evan Smith, Samantha Read, and Adriel Rodriguez as a prep ... also ran cross country and played soccer ... school was named El Camino League champions for junior and senior seasons ... named Most Valuable Runner for sophomore, junior, and senior seasons ... El Camino League Champion in the 800M, 1600M, and 4X400 relay for senior season ... placed second in CCS for 800M senior year ... qualified for state meet in the 800M senior year ...named All League for Camino division for sophomore, junior, and senior seasons ...
